WebMar 2, 2024 · Dire wolves were about the same length as gray wolves, but they weighed between 125 and 175 pounds more than their modern cousins (Canis lupus). The wolves likely hunted bison, ancient horses, and even small mastodons and mammoths in packs, as other wolves do today. WebApr 1, 2024 · The dire wolf ( Canis dirus) had a broad geographic range in Pleistocene North and South America. Webdire wolf, ( Aenocyon dirus ), canine that existed during the Pleistocene Epoch (2.6 million to 11,700 years ago). It is probably the most common mammalian species to be found preserved in the La Brea Tar Pits in … dr. chet whitleyWebOct 12, 2024 · The large number of dire wolf fossils found at Rancho La Brea have suggested that like modern gray wolves and other canids, dire wolves formed large social groups to help hunt and raise pups. Sexual dimorphism is seen in male and female dire wolves with the males being larger and a bit more robust than the females.
